What's a Healthy Body Weight for Your Age?

Nutritional needs change as you get older, and you may have to fight the battle of the bulge throughout your senior years. By Diana Rodriguez Medically Reviewed by Cynthia Haines, MD Shouldn't one of the joys of aging be to finally forget about your weight and just relax? Unfortunately, even as a senior you have to think about weight management. In fact, it can become more difficult as you age because of changes in your body. Why It's a Challenge to Maintain Your Weight as You Age It can be perplexing: You find it a little harder to fit into your regular pants, and an extra walk each day just isn't taking care of those extra pounds. Even if you haven't changed your diet habits, your body is changing. It's much easier for seniors to gain weight and much tougher to lose it.
